Danish Prime Minister Mette Frederiksen said this during her speech at a ceremony to raise Ukraine’s National Flag, an Ukrinform correspondent reports.
Addressing Ukrainians, the Danish Prime Minister stressed that defending Kharkiv and Odesa also means defending Riga, Helsinki, and Copenhagen
“Denmark and the Nordic and Baltic countries stand with you. From the very beginning, we knew that this war could not be won with words alone. When you urgently needed weapons and ammunition, we provided them. When you needed tanks and our F-16s, we provided them. When you needed investment in your own defense industry, we provided it. And now, when you are in urgent need of strong air defense, we must promise to provide it,” Frederiksen said.
She recalled that Denmark and other countries had jointly committed to rapidly developing a new missile system to protect Ukrainian cities and strengthen Europe’s defenses.
“Our support cannot be measured in money. It can be measured by one simple promise: for as long as it takes,” the Danish Prime Minister assured.

As reported, on Sunday, August 23, Ukraine is celebrating National Flag Day. In addition to Denmark’s Prime Minister, President of Finland Alexander Stubb, President of Lithuania Gitanas Nausėda, Prime Minister of Norway Jonas Gahr Støre, Estonian Prime Minister Kristen Michal, and Latvian Prime Minister Andris Kulbergs arrived in Kyiv.
